The Epson ET-4550 delivers reliable printing, but periodic maintenance routines can increase the waste ink counter and eventually trigger a ‘Service Required’ lock.

The Epson ET-4550 tracks waste ink with an internal counter. Because it is an estimate (not a physical sensor), it may trigger before the pads are actually full.

How the Error Appears

  • ‘Service Required’ / service life message in driver or utility
  • Maintenance/support code (varies by model/driver)
  • Printing stops after cleaning cycles
  • Warning repeats after restarting the printer
